For customers who come to deliver goods, the warehouse keeper should take the initiative to provide standardized and enthusiastic services for customers. 2. The warehouse keeper should take the initiative to assist the customer in handling the delivery procedures, such as filling in the waybill and answering customer inquiries. 3. For the goods to be shipped, ask the destination station first. For those who have difficulty reaching their destination. Consult the customer service room first. 4. When loading and unloading goods, ask the name of the goods first, and handle them with care. For fragile and upward items, be more careful and stick fragile or upward labels on the packaging in time to show the difference. 5. When loading and unloading goods, if the package is found to be damaged, check whether the internal goods are damaged or lost, and suggest the customer to repackage them if necessary. 6. Loading and unloading personnel should establish safety first. For the consigned goods, it is necessary to check whether the goods conform to the name in advance to determine whether there are inflammable, explosive and other prohibited items. Once any prohibited items are found, they should be rejected immediately. Never leave it in the warehouse. 7. If the goods need to show certificates according to regulations, customers should be reminded to show relevant certificates. 8. When weighing the goods, the warehouse keeper shall determine the weight of the goods together with the delivery customer. 9. If the goods are slightly immersed in water, the volume shall be measured face to face with the customer according to the company's regulations, and the billing weight shall be calculated, and truthfully filled in on the consignment note. 5438+00. The warehouse keeper should take the initiative to ask the customer whether reinforcement or secondary packaging is needed. If the customer makes a request, he should actively meet it, and truthfully fill in the packing fee in the consignment note according to the company's regulations. For the items such as weight and packing fee filled in by the warehouse keeper, no one may change or waive the fee without the instructions of the company leader. After weighing the goods and filling in the waybill, the weighing personnel shall sign the waybill for confirmation. 13. Full-time storekeepers should be responsible for the storage of goods in the warehouse. We must be vigilant and resolutely put an end to potential safety hazards. 2. The goods in the warehouse should be kept in a fully reasonable and orderly manner, and the goods should be packaged clearly and neatly, and passages should be set aside according to regulations to ensure smooth flow. 3. The storekeeper shall count the goods in the warehouse together with the stevedores and the personnel on duty half an hour after work every day, and make clean-up and records. The warehouse keeper and stevedore are responsible for the damaged and lost items found before and after work that day; In other cases, the shopkeeper should be responsible for the damaged and lost goods. 5. The warehouse keeper should know about the goods in stock and keep abreast of the inventory situation. Any abnormal goods, such as loose and damaged packaging, should be identified and handled in time. 6. The warehouse is very important, and irrelevant personnel are forbidden to enter. If a large number of goods need to be packed in the warehouse, the customer should check and supervise, and with the consent of the leader, accompanied by the keeper or the duty officer, the number of people entering the warehouse shall not exceed three. 7. Only departing goods and spare materials of the company can be stored in the warehouse, and other irrelevant goods are not allowed to enter the warehouse. If other articles need to be stacked, they must be approved by the company leaders and stacked at the designated place according to the requirements of the keeper. The stacking period shall not exceed 30 days, and the storage fee shall be charged appropriately. If the warehouse area is tight and the storage location is limited, the storekeeper may refuse to put the goods or surplus goods into the warehouse. 8. Other personnel of the company must register and hand over the goods or spare materials to the storekeeper. 9. The keeper shall summarize and register the usage of consumables in the warehouse every day, make regular inventory, and hand over consumables entering and leaving the warehouse together with the stevedores, make inventory, register and sign. 10, and the storekeeper shall be responsible for the five precautions of the warehouse and check it regularly. Personnel shall check the delivery list and manifest of the arrived goods to ensure that the delivery list and manifest are consistent. In the process of loading and unloading, if the goods are found to be damaged, unpacked and without manifest, the abnormal goods should be put into the abnormal cargo hold and registered in the accident error register. After unloading, the warehouse keeper shall recheck the goods according to the handover list and count them one by one to ensure that the goods are in conformity. After the handover process is completed, the warehouse keeper should sign the handover form and file it. 2. Receiving and receiving goods: a. For the goods delivered and received at home, the warehouse keeper must unpack and inspect the goods according to the regulations, and extract more than 30%. Strictly prevent the goods collected and transported from being mixed (the annex is attached). Those that do not meet the requirements shall be repackaged. After weighing, the warehouse keeper should check whether the consignor fills in the invoice according to the regulations. And sign the weight of the goods for confirmation. After reviewing the goods and consignment note, the warehouse keeper signs the consignment note to show his responsibility. After the goods are put into storage, they should be placed in the designated location. B, for the goods that need to be packaged or the owner has requirements, the warehouse keeper shall determine the packaging method according to the specific conditions of the goods. If packing materials such as boards, foams and cartons need to be used, the warehouse keeper should fill in the name, specification and quantity of the materials used item by item on the outbound order. And indicate the total packing fee on the consignment note. The packing fee is charged according to the amount indicated on the consignment note when the counter sales staff prints the bill of lading. 3. Goods of all business departments of the company: a.
